North Tyneside Borough Council, in partnership with Northumberland County Council, is seeking a provider to deliver support services for people experiencing rough sleeping or at risk of rough sleeping across both local authority areas.
The procurement is being undertaken under the Open Procedure in accordance with the Procurement Act 2023. The successful provider will deliver tailored support services as part of a wider approach to preventing homelessness, reducing rough sleeping, and helping individuals access appropriate accommodation and support.
The Councils state that the service forms part of a broader programme of measures designed to support households experiencing homelessness, including people sleeping rough.
Buyer – North Tyneside Borough Council and Northumberland County Council
Deadline – 13 July 2026 – 12:00pm
Contract Value – £525,000 excluding VAT (£630,000 including VAT)
Delivery Length – 1 September 2026 to 31 August 2029, with the option to extend for two further one-year periods until 31 August 2031.
